CYS_Embedded Software Engineer_GCAP
Location: IT - Catania
Time Type: Full time
Job Description
Job Description:
Leonardo è uno dei partner industriali strategici del programma GCAP (Global Combat Air Programme), insieme alla britannica BAE Systems e alla giapponese Mitsubishi Heavy Industries, finalizzato allo sviluppo e alla realizzazione di un sistema aereo di nuova generazione, definito come “sistema di sistemi”. Impiegato per operazioni multidominio in ambito difesa, il sistema sarà
caratterizzato da una “core platform” connessa con altri sistemi periferici “adjuncts”, pilotati e non pilotati.
Il programma, tra i più sfidanti e avveniristici per l’industria dell’aerospazio e della difesa, guiderà la rivoluzione tecnologica che
caratterizzerà il settore nei prossimi cinquant’anni. Una sfida finalizzata a rafforzare la sovranità tecnologica e industriale dei paesi coinvolti, perché punta a identificare e a rendere disponibili quelle tecnologie innovative, dette abilitanti, che assicureranno il salto generazionale, generando ritorni positivi e progresso economico e sociale per l’intero sistema Paese, a beneficio delle nuove
generazioni.
Le risorse che lavoreranno all’interno di questo programma avranno l’opportunità di accedere ad un percorso di crescita
professionale in un contesto internazionale e tecnologicamente avanzato.
All’interno dell’Area Cyber & Security Solutions, stiamo ricercando un/a Embedded Software Engineer per la nostra sede di Catania.
La persona, in sinergia con il team di sviluppo software, si occuperà delle seguenti attività:
- Progettare e sviluppare software per sistemi embedded utilizzando i linguaggi C, C++ e Ada
- Scrivere codice efficiente, modulare e manutenibile per applicazioni real-time
- Analizzare i requisiti tecnici e contribuire alla definizione dell’architettura software
- Eseguire attività di debugging, testing e validazione su sistemi embedded
- Ottimizzare le prestazioni e la sicurezza del software in ambienti a risorse limitate
- Collaborare con team di progettazione hardware e firmware per l’integrazione di soluzioni software
- Redigere documentazione tecnica e partecipare alle revisioni del codice
Titolo di studio: Laurea in Ingegneria Informatica, Elettronica, Telecomunicazioni, Informatica o discipline affini
Seniority: Senior: 5+ anni di esperienza
Conoscenze e competenze tecniche:
- Esperienza nello sviluppo software embedded in C, C++ e Ada
- Conoscenza dei sistemi operativi real-time (RTOS) e delle problematiche di programmazione real-time
- Esperienza con microcontrollori, microprocessori e sistemi a risorse limitate
- Conoscenza di protocolli di comunicazione (UART, SPI, I2C, CAN, Ethernet)
- Esperienza con strumenti di versioning del codice (Git, SVN)
- Conoscenza delle metodologie di testing software per sistemi embedded (unit testing, integration testing)
- Esperienza con strumenti di debugging e profiling per software embedded
- Familiarità con standard di sicurezza e certificazioni nel settore (es. DO-178C, ISO 26262, MISRA C)
Competenze comportamentali:
- Capacità di problem-solving e analisi dei requisiti
- Attitudine al lavoro in team e alla collaborazione interdisciplinare
- Buona gestione del tempo e autonomia nella pianificazione delle attività
- Precisione e attenzione ai dettagli nella scrittura del codice e nella documentazione tecnica
- Capacità di adattamento a contesti e tecnologie in evoluzione
Conoscenze linguistiche:
Inglese: Buona conoscenza (minimo B2) per la lettura di documentazione tecnica e la comunicazione con team internazional
Competenze informatiche:
- Familiarità con ambienti di sviluppo embedded (Keil, IAR, Eclipse, GCC, Green Hills)
- Conoscenza di strumenti per simulazione e modellazione software (es. Matlab/Simulink)
- Esperienza con ambienti di Continuous Integration e Continuous Deployment (CI/CD)
Altro (es. Disponibilità a trasferte, Certificazioni specifiche…):
Disponibilità a trasferte nazionali e internazionali
Esperienza in settori critici (Aerospaziale, Automotive, Difesa, Ferroviario) è un plus
Seniority:
Primary Location:
IT - CataniaAdditional Locations:
Contract Type:
PermanentHybrid Working:
There are more than 50,000 engineering jobs:
Subscribe to membership and unlock all jobs
Engineering Jobs
60,000+ jobs from 4,500+ well-funded companies
Updated Daily
New jobs are added every day as companies post them
Refined Search
Use filters like skill, location, etc to narrow results
Become a member
🥳🥳🥳 452 happy customers and counting...
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.
To try it out
For active job seekers
For those who are passive looking
Cancel anytime
Frequently Asked Questions
- We prioritize job seekers as our customers, unlike bigger job sites, by charging a small fee to provide them with curated access to the best companies and up-to-date jobs. This focus allows us to deliver a more personalized and effective job search experience.
- We've got over 200,000 jobs from 15,000+ vetted companies. No fake or sleazy jobs here!
- We aggregate jobs from 15,000+ companies' career pages, so you can be sure that you're getting the most up-to-date and relevant jobs.
- We're the only job board *for* software engineers, *by* software engineers… in case you needed a reminder! We add thousands of new jobs daily and offer powerful search filters just for you. 🛠️
- Every single hour! We add 2,000-3,000 new jobs daily, so you'll always have fresh opportunities. 🚀
- Typically, job searches take 3-6 months. EchoJobs helps you spend more time applying and less time hunting. 🎯
- Check daily! We're always updating with new jobs. Set up job alerts for even quicker access. 📅
What Fellow Engineers Say
